Understanding Bull Plug Definition and Applications


The term bull plug may not be familiar to many, yet it plays a crucial role in various fields, particularly in engineering and plumbing. To grasp the concept fully, we must first define what a bull plug is.


A bull plug, sometimes referred to as a pipe plug, is a mechanical device used to seal the ends of pipes, tubes, or fittings. It is designed to prevent the escape of fluids or gases, ensuring that systems remain pressurized and leak-free. Bull plugs are usually shaped like a cylindrical piece with a threaded end that can be screwed into a corresponding opening. They come in various sizes, materials, and designs to cater to different applications.


Understanding Bull Plug Definition and Applications


One of the primary applications of a bull plug is in plumbing systems. For instance, when constructing a new pipeline or during maintenance work, a bull plug can seal off unused pipe ends to prevent water from leaking out. Additionally, they can serve to block off sections of a system during repairs, ensuring that work can be conducted without the risk of water escaping and causing damage.

In the realm of oil and gas, bull plugs are indispensable. They are utilized in a variety of applications, including wellhead equipment, where they help maintain pressure and prevent leakage of hydrocarbons. They not only ensure the safety of the system but also help in adhering to environmental regulations by preventing spills.


In industrial applications, bull plugs also play a vital role. They are often found in manufacturing plants where large machinery utilizes piping to operate. The plugs ensure that hydraulic systems remain sealed, preventing leaks that could lead to operational downtime or hazardous situations. By using bull plugs, companies can minimize risks and enhance the efficiency of their processes.


When it comes to installation, the use of bull plugs is relatively straightforward, yet it requires careful attention. Proper threading is essential to achieving a tight seal, and it is important to select the correct size to match the pipe dimensions. Moreover, the application of appropriate sealants or Teflon tape can improve the effectiveness of the seal and reduce the likelihood of leaks.


In addition to their sealing capabilities, bull plugs can also serve as temporary closures during the testing phase of a pipeline or system. Before commissioning, systems are often pressure-tested to ensure that there are no leaks. Bull plugs can be integrated into this process by sealing off points of potential failure.
